Securing the Internet of Things: Key Considerations
The Growing Importance of IoT Security
The proliferation of Internet of Things (IoT) devices has transformed the way we interact with technology, from smart homes to industrial automation. However, this interconnectedness also presents significant security challenges. In this article, we delve into the essential considerations for securing the IoT landscape and examine real-world examples of both vulnerabilities and effective security measures.
Understanding IoT Security Risks
1. Vulnerable Devices and Networks:
- IoT devices often lack robust security features, making them susceptible to hacking and unauthorized access.
- Examples include compromised smart home devices, industrial control systems, and connected medical devices.
2. Data Privacy Concerns:
- IoT devices collect vast amounts of sensitive data, raising concerns about privacy and potential misuse.
- Instances of data breaches and unauthorized data access highlight the importance of stringent privacy measures.
Key Considerations for IoT Security
1. Device Authentication and Authorization:
- Implementing strong authentication mechanisms ensures that only authorized users and devices can access IoT networks.
- Examples include biometric authentication, multi-factor authentication, and device certificates.
2. Encryption and Data Protection:
- Encrypting data both in transit and at rest safeguards sensitive information from interception and unauthorized access.
- Secure communication protocols like TLS (Transport Layer Security) and AES (Advanced Encryption Standard) are crucial for protecting IoT data.
Securing IoT Infrastructure
1. Network Segmentation:
- Segmenting IoT devices into separate networks reduces the attack surface and mitigates the impact of potential breaches.
- Firewalls, VLANs (Virtual Local Area Networks), and access control policies help enforce network segmentation.
2. Regular Software Updates and Patch Management:
- Keeping IoT devices and associated software up-to-date is essential for addressing known vulnerabilities and security flaws.
- Automated patch management systems streamline the process of deploying security updates across large IoT deployments.
Real-World Examples
-
Mirai Botnet: The Mirai botnet exploited vulnerabilities in IoT devices, such as cameras and routers, to launch large-scale distributed denial-of-service (DDoS) attacks.
-
Stuxnet Worm: The Stuxnet worm targeted industrial control systems, highlighting the potential consequences of IoT security breaches in critical infrastructure.
Emerging Technologies and Best Practices
1. Blockchain for IoT Security:
- Blockchain technology offers decentralized and tamper-resistant data storage, enhancing the integrity and security of IoT transactions.
- Applications include secure device provisioning, supply chain traceability, and tamper-proof data logging.
2. Security by Design:
- Integrating security considerations into the design and development process of IoT devices promotes a proactive approach to cybersecurity.
- Adhering to industry standards and frameworks such as the OWASP IoT Top Ten and the NIST Cybersecurity Framework ensures robust security measures from the outset.
Securing the Internet of Things is a multifaceted challenge that requires a comprehensive approach encompassing device security, network infrastructure, and data protection. By understanding the key considerations and adopting best practices, organizations can mitigate risks and safeguard the integrity and privacy of IoT ecosystems. As IoT continues to proliferate across various domains, prioritizing security is paramount to realizing its full potential in the digital age.